"2020 has not been without its challenges for those in the world of buying and selling businesses. The bedrock of M&A activity is confidence, and this has been shaken since the onset of Covid-19.

That said, the Leeds M&A team at Mazars has delivered its second best ever year. We have our clients to thank for this and have been privileged to have worked with some great people with great businesses. A number of these have been highly resilient to change and we have been able to deliver their purchase or sale as planned, albeit through Teams and Zoom rather than in the conventional manner.

Many challenges lie ahead – we still have no clarity on a Brexit trade deal and, whilst social distancing remains in force, many service businesses will be unable to return to any form of normality.

The press can often paint a rather one-sided picture on business and it is fair to say that we are seeing many prospering also. Businesses manufacturing or distributing consumer goods have received a Covid-19 fillip as cash not spent during lockdown or put aside for holidays has been spent in other ways. From a M&A perspective, we are seeing larger corporates flush with cash keen to make well-priced acquisitions and regarding now to be a time to do so. The same can be said in the world of private equity and with the high street banks focusing heavily on supporting businesses with difficulties in their portfolios, never has the expression “cash is king” resonated more in the world of M&A.

We are already seeing international groups looking to divest of UK subsidiaries so as to free up cash and focus on the motherland. This is creating opportunities for management teams to take ownership through circumstance.

To quote Albert Einstein “in the middle of difficulty lies opportunity”.
